WebAug 27, 2015 · The example OPM uses someone on retained pay at the GS-11 level is being promoted to the GS-12. By adding two steps to the GS-11 step 10 rate, the example indicates that the lowest step that equals or exceeds that amount is the GS-12 step 6. The minimum SES salary is 120 percent of the salary for GS-15, step … WebThere are 10 steps in each of the GS and LEO grades. There are only 5 steps for the FWS schedule. For GS and LEO, the first three step increases occur every year, the next three step increases occur every two years, and the final three step increases occur every three …
